Remarks of Robt. E.C. Stearns and Resolutions of the California Academy of Sciences On the Death of Benjamin Parke Avery [At Its Regular Meeting Dec.

This volume collects the remarks of Robert E.C. Stearns and the resolutions passed by the California Academy of Sciences upon the death of Benjamin Parke Avery. Presented at the Academy's regular meeting on December 6, 1875, these documents offer a glimpse into the life and contributions of Avery within the scientific and literary community of 19th-century California.

The text provides valuable historical context regarding the scientific endeavors and intellectual pursuits of the era, commemorating Avery's achievements and underscoring the impact of his work. This publication serves as a historical record and tribute to a notable figure in the development of science on the American West Coast. For researchers interested in the history of science, California history, or biographical accounts of prominent individuals, this work provides unique insights into the life and legacy of Benjamin Parke Avery.
